First manga I've ever read in the Japanese page order. A bit weird, but you get used to it.
Lovecraft stories are good, and the art is generally dark and gloomy, as it should. Perhaps a tad too dark and murky. But not bad.
But why is there a Nazi flag flying in the U-Boot, when Lovecraft wrote the story in the 1920s and it's set in the World War I? Imperial Navy didn't use the Nazi flag, that much I know.
Also, the Finnish translator botched the famous couplet, coming up with something clunky instead of using the standard Finnish translation.
